McGregor ends his five-year hiatus from the Ultimate Fighting Championship against Holloway, 13 years after their first meeting. They squared off on Aug. 17, 2013, at UFC Fight Night 26 in Boston, where the Irishman emerged victorious via decision. Holloway has now addressed two key aspects of his preparation that he believes will boost his performance at UFC 329.
Max Holloway training changes for Conor McGregor UFC 329 rematchIn an interview with ESPN MMA, Holloway discussed how his training camp went. With his upcoming bout being contested at welterweight, “Blessed” made sure to leave no stone unturned in preparation. He even roped in former 170-pound champion Jack Della Maddalena for assistance.“I think it's going to be a fun fight, man. I think it’d be great.
